Van Halen's Balance to Receive 30th Anniversary Expanded Reissue
Briefly

Van Halen's iconic 1995 album Balance is set for a significant 30th-anniversary expanded reissue on August 15th. This edition will present remastered audio, bonus tracks, and live recordings from their 1995 performance at Wembley Stadium. It includes three non-album tracks, consolidating all officially released studio content from this era. While the standalone vinyl features the original tracklist, bonus materials are available on the 2-CD edition and deluxe box set, which also contains exclusive music videos. Notably absent is the shelved song "Between Us Two," which fans hoped would make this reissue.
